RE: Custom Chaos Emeralds - Cobalt Blue - 07-09-2009 The main issue, besides the way the emeralds are labeled, is that their polygonal shape isnt really that well defined. they do look quite flat since of of the faces of trhe said emerald should reflect in some degree the light from the lightsource, thus helping in the definition of each shape. while this is not a must, you really need to state that the emeralds are indeed, diamond shaped objects. saying "every sonic fan would recognize them" its nothing but a bad excuse, specially considering that if you didnt say that they are the chaos emeralds, they could be read as simple jewerly that could easily be labeled like "these are custom colums gems" or anything like that. look at the Emeralds in Sonic Pocket, they are well defined, use way less colors but really achieves the sense of a 3D object and gives them a more dinamic and attractive point of view.
